    We use black butyl tape to fill the gaps under the bed rail caps at the front. As well as clear lexel rubber sealant on the front edge of the caps and under the front of the bed bar. Seems to work well but not absolutely perfect.

    Hi brother,
    For the sides you just need to un-snap the trim (left and right sides of the box). For the front, the metal header piece you need to unscrew (you will need a star socket). Instead of silicone I myself used polyurethane (you can find it at automotive stores, or maybe home depot might have it. Benefit of urethane over silicone is that it provides a seal without separation, silicone will). Then seal as much as you can, two tubes did the trick for me.

    And for the Prinsu rack to mount, I had to buy some weld nuts and different bolts that would slide into the t-track on top. Then I had to file the holes on the mounting brackets for the Prinsu so that the new hardware would fit through. Really easy! I just used a dremel to file out the holes.
